What is push fit pipe?

Push fit fittings are a popular alternative to traditional fittings. Just push the pipework into the fitting to create a watertight seal. A wide range of plastic and copper fittings are available. Plastic push fit plumbing fittings are usually demountable, whereas copper fittings are not.

Can you reuse push fit plumbing?

Certain push-fit fittings, such as Speedfit brand, can be removed by hand and reused. Others may need a special tool to remove them for reuse. Some brands cannot be reused at all.

Will a SharkBite fitting work on copper pipe?

SharkBite brass push-to-connect fittings are compatible with PEX, Copper, CPVC, PE-RT and HDPE pipe. SharkBite fittings come with a PEX stiffener pre-loaded into the fitting for PEX, PE-RT and HDPE. The PEX stiffener does not need to be removed for Copper or CPVC applications.

What are the different types of plumbing fittings?

Fittings are generally used in mechanical and plumbing operations for a number of different purposes. There are many different kinds of fittings, made from a variety of materials: some of the most common types are elbows, tees, wyes, crosses, couplings, unions, compression fittings, caps, plugs and valves.
